Abstract

We have calculated the ionosphere and thermosphere disturbances caused by the vertical electric currents flowing across the lower boundary of the ionosphere from the below lying atmosphere. The global numerical Upper Atmosphere Model (UAM) has been used for the calculations with the vertical electric currents at its lower boundary (80 km) as a model input for the electric potential equation. Different locations, spatial configurations and intensities of the vertical electric currents have been investigated. Their physical nature has been discussed in relation with the mesoscale disturbances of the Global Electric Circuit, such as thunderstorm activity, typhoons, sandstorms, volcano eruptions, earthquakes, anthropogenic pollutions, etc.
